Induction Ranges from GE, Whirlpool, and Frigidaire
Induction Range Comparisons Best Price and Selection at Universal Appliance and Kitchen Center Buying a New Range? Consider an induction range. Prices have come down, and the technology is superb and reliable. The induction rangetop will give you more power and responsiveness than gas, and the clean smooth glass cooktop stays cool. Spills wipe up easily. Here are induction ranges from three big brands. Frigidaire, Whirlpool, and GE.Frigidaire FPIF3093LF The Frigidaire induction range has a hybrid cooktop that offers great versatility with 2 induction elements, and up to 3 electric elements. The 10" induction element offers up to 3,400 watts of power, so you can bring water to a boil quickly. The range has a convection oven, and a warming drawer. The interface makes operation incredibly easy and allows for precise control of burner temperatures.Whirlpool WFI910H0AS Whirlpool's induction range has the industry's largest oven capacity at 6.2 cu.ft. with a true convection oven. The rangetop includes a powerful 9" 3,200 watt induction boost element. In addition, Whirlpool's range also includes a warming drawer. The oven has Whirlpool's unique AquaLift ® self-clean technology.GE PHB9255P3SS The GE Profile induction range has simple NextStep controls that light and lead you through the settings for precise, consistent results. The rangetop has 4 induction elements including a large 11" 3700 watt element. It also has a convenient 6" 100 watt warming zone element. The -

Big Oven for a Big Space, Wolf 36" SO36U/S
Wolf L Series 36" Built-In Single Oven Today's Feature at Universal Appliance and Kitchen CenterA perfect choice to fit under a 36" cooktop or in a big 36" wall cabinet, the Wolf L series 36" built-in oven model SO36U/S has an unframed door design that gives the SO36U/S oven model L series 36" a contemporary look. The Wolf Dual convection system delivers superior results and faster cooking; the temperature probe gives you fine control. The easy-to-use electronic control panel rotates into position. When not in use, it’s hidden behind a stainless steel panel. Nobody wants their 36" wide cooktop to dwarf their wall oven, yet most oven manufacturers don't offer an oven over 30" wide. Wolf solves that problem with the SO36U/S, an oven that has all the luxury features of their 30" ovens, but offering the wider footprint that fills out a 36" wide cabinet. Similarly, the SO366U/S is a perfect choice to use in 36" wide upper wall cabinetry.This appliance is certified by Star-K to meet strict religious regulations in conjunction with specific instructions found on www.star-k.org. Features • Unframed door style in stainless steelfinish. • Dual convection logic control system. • Ten cooking modes—bake, roast, broil, convection bake, convection roast, convection broil, convection, bake stone (accessory required), dehydrate (accessory required) and proof. • Rotating glass touch control panel. • Cobalt blue porcelain oven interior. • Five-level rack guides -

The GE range below has traditional coil elements, but is updated with a huge self-cleaning oven, big window, and a PowerBoil™ coil element. While radiant smooth top ranges and gas burners have many advantages, coil elements have been proven to boil water faster than any current cooking method except induction. Also, coil elements are a favorite of home canning aficionados. And some traditionalists just prefer using the electric coil elements with which they are comfortable. GE® 30" Free-Standing Electric Range *Self-clean ovenCleans the oven cavity without the need for scrubbing5.3 cu. ft. oven capacityEnough room to cook an entire meal at oncePowerBoil™ coil elementProduces rapid, powerful heatHeavy-duty roller rackProvides easy access to oven interiorBig view windowEnjoy a clear view of the food you’re cookingDual element bakeUpper and lower elements produce even heat and great results *Self-Clean Ovens Baking is often a messy process, with spills, spatters, boil-overs, drips and drops. When the baking is done the cleaning begins. Luckily, GE Appliances invented and patented the first self-clean oven in 1963. A new way to clean your oven - SteamClean from Whirlpool
How often do you clean your oven? Annually? Once every 6 months? Whenever it gets so dirty you can't stand it anymore? How would you like to be able to clean your oven with very little bother as often as you'd like so that it always looked nice? Whirlpool has a new oven cleaning system that allows you to clean your oven using only water and some heat to steam clean the oven. There are no harsh chemicals and very little energy is required. The trick is to clean the oven frequently - ie. whenever it gets dirty from usage. Using only a cup and a quarter of water in the bottom of the oven during a cleaning cycle, the oven creates some steam softens any lightly baked on material or soil which then is easy to wipe up. It's a clever idea, very effective, environmentally friendly and energy saving.
